No, there is no map that exists that tells you that you are on a handsfree BlueCruise road. It was promised for May 2022...
You can turn on cruise (you already have the other options on), and have hands-on assisted driving, the car will stay between the lines, take turns, etc. You just keep your hands on the wheel and let it steer.
When you get on a divided highway that is handsfree, the instrument panel will tell you that you can remove your hands from the wheel. As you approach areas where you need to put your hands back on (i.e. big curve in the road), it will tell you.
